For use only in commercial seed treatment equipment. Not for use in hopper box, planter box, slurry box, or other on-farm seed treatment applications.
PRODUCT INFORMATION AND INSTRUCTIONS
VOTiVO 240 FS:
- is a biological seed treatment that, when applied to seed, colonizes the developing root system and provides early season protection from plant pathogenic nematodes that attack the root. As a result of this biological protection, a vigorous root system is established by the plant, which often results in more uniform plants and greater yields.
- is recommended for use with Bayer CropScience seed applied insecticides and fungicides for complete pest protection.
- In areas of high nematode infestation, additional control measures may be warranted.
- Apply VOTiVO 240 FS as water-based slurry either alone or with other registered seed treatment insecticides and fungicides through standard slurry or mist commercial seed treatment equipment.
- can be tank mixed with other seed treatments in accordance with the most restrictive label limitations and precautions of all products used in the mixture.
- All seed treated with this product must be colored with an EPA-approved dye or colorant that imparts an unnatural color to the seed to help prevent the inadvertent use of treated seed for food, feed, or oil purposes.
